Denham train station caters to every traveler with facilities ensuring comfort and accessibility. The ticket office operates early morning to early afternoon, with extended hours on Saturdays, and while it may not be staffed throughout the day, there's a dependable helpline available for assistance. Online shoppers have the convenience of ticket collection at available machines that are fully accessible, featuring an induction loop to assist those with hearing disabilities.
For those with mobility needs, rest assured Denham station boasts step-free access across all platforms. Travelers will find accessible toilets and reasonable seating arrangements, though it's worth noting the absence of a traditional waiting room and 1st Class Lounge. While the temporary toilet setup may seem inconvenient due to ongoing repair works, it's complemented by a set-down point right at the entrance and ample parking that includes accessible spaces.
Denham's connectivity doesn't halt at trains. You'll find a robust link to Heathrow Airport with the 724 bus service, perfect for when air travel is on the cards. Moreover, rail replacement services and local buses enhance the populous transport network, ensuring that last-mile connectivity isn't compromised. The station prides itself on user-friendly ticketing options. With a ticket office operational Monday through Saturday from 06:55 to 13:30 and ticket machines available for those outside these hours, purchasing or collecting tickets bought online remains hassle-free. Additionally, these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ts to ensure accessibility for all passengers.
As you navigate the station, you'll find helpful staff available during the same hours as the ticket office to answer questions or assist with your travel needs. For auditory announcements and visual departure screens, London Road (Brighton) ensures you're updated on your journey. And if you need more personalized assistance, help points are conveniently located on the platforms.
Although not all areas offer step-free access, the station provides options to accommodate travelers with mobility needs. Ramps are available for train access, though it’s essential to arrange this in advance or upon arrival if needed. Staff trained to provide assistance aboard trains can help ensure a smooth journey. Remember, arriving 20 minutes early allows staff to coordinate any required accessibility assistance at your destination or connecting stations.
While there are no accessible restrooms or waiting rooms, seating areas are present for comfort while you wait for your train.
